Before diving into the maintenance regimen, it's necessary to acknowledge the signs that your door hinges might need attention:
Creaking Noises: A typical indicator of friction due to absence of lubrication.Rust or Corrosion: Presence of rust suggests that hinges are exposed to moisture and need cleansing.Wobbling or Misalignment: Hinges that are loose can result in doors hanging improperly.Visible Damage: Cracks or chips in the hinge can compromise its stability.Steps for Effective Door Hinge Maintenance
Maintaining door hinges is a simple process, often requiring minimal products. Below is a detailed guide for homeowners to follow:

Gather Supplies:
Oil or lubricant (silicone spray, penetrating oil, or grease)Soft clothsCleaning solution (mild soap and water)ScrewdriverWire brush (if rust exists)Protective gloves (optional)
Inspect the Hinges:
Open and close the door to observe for creaking, misalignment, or excessive play.
Tidy the Hinges:
If there's visible debris or rust, utilize a wet fabric or the wire brush to scrub off any gunk. For rust, ensure all particles are eliminated.
Oil the Hinges:
Apply a percentage of lube straight onto the knuckle and along the pin. For accuracy application, consider using a lubricant applicator.
Look for Tightness:
Use a screwdriver to tighten up any loose screws. Guarantee the hinge is firmly secured to both the door and frame.
Evaluate the Operation:

It's finest to use a silicone-based lubricant or a permeating oil. Avoid using grease, as it can draw in dirt and dust.
2. How do I remove rust from my hinges?
Utilize a wire brush and soapy water to scrub off rust. For tougher spots, a rust dissolver can likewise work.
3. Can I replace a hinge myself?
Yes, changing a door hinge is an uncomplicated task that involves getting rid of screws and changing the hinge. Nevertheless, guarantee you have the right size and type for compatibility.
